


Latitude 53
Currently located on the ground floor of the historic McLeod Building, just steps from where the gallery first opened 50 years ago, Latitude 53 is one of Canada’s oldest artist-run centres dedicated to supporting artists. The gallery exhibits local, national and international work, showcasing artists engaged with contemporary culture. Expect to see thought-provoking exhibitions and engage with artists in intimate workshops as part of the gallery’s offerings. L53 has presented significant exhibitions by notable Canadian artists in the formative stages of their careers. At its core, the gallery is driven by and for artists, with group shows remaining at the heart of its programming. Recent exhibitions highlight the collaborative, scrappy and local heart of the organization. Today, Latitude 53 is one of the largest and oldest centres in the Canadian Prairies, and it serves as a major centre for contemporary art in Northern Alberta.
